Ingredients
For the Creamy Base
- 4 ounces room temperature cream cheese
- 1/3 cup sour cream
- 2 tablespoons extra virgin olive oil
- 1-2 grated garlic cloves
- 1 tablespoon fresh chives, chopped
- Salt and pepper to taste
- 3/4 cup crumbled cotija or feta cheese
For the Pasta Salad
- 1 pound of short pasta
- 1 head romaine lettuce, shredded
- 2 cups grilled or roasted corn (from 3-4 fresh ears)
- 1/2 cup fresh basil, torn
- 1/2 cup fresh cilantro, chopped
- 1/2 cup spicy cheddar cheese, diced
For Seasoning and Garnish
- 1 avocado, diced
- 4 tablespoons salted butter
- 2 teaspoons smoked paprika
- 2 tablespoons chili powder
- 1/2 to 2 teaspoons cayenne pepper, adjust to preference
- 1/4 cup mayonnaise or yogurt
- 2 tablespoons lime juice
How to Make Creamy Street Corn Pasta Salad
Step 1: Cook the Pasta
Boil water in a large pot. Add salt once boiling.
1. Add the short pasta.
2. Cook according to package directions until al dente.
3. Drain using a colander and set aside to cool.
Step 2: Prepare the Creamy Dressing
In a mixing bowl:
1. Combine room temperature cream cheese, sour cream, olive oil, grated garlic cloves, chives, salt, and pepper.
2. Mix until smooth and creamy.
Step 3: Combine Ingredients
In the same mixing bowl or another large bowl:
1. Add cooked pasta and cooled corn.
2. Fold in shredded romaine lettuce, torn basil, chopped cilantro, diced spicy cheddar cheese, and diced avocado.
3. Pour in the creamy dressing; mix gently until everything is well coated.
Step 4: Season Your Salad
Sprinkle smoked paprika, chili powder, cayenne pepper (to taste), mayonnaise (or yogurt), and lime juice over the salad mixture.
1. Toss gently to combine all flavors.
2. Adjust seasoning as needed.
Step 5: Serve Chilled
Refrigerate for about 30 minutes before serving if desired. Enjoy your Creamy Street Corn Pasta Salad chilled!

Common Mistakes to Avoid
Making Creamy Street Corn Pasta Salad can be a delightful experience, but there are common mistakes to watch out for.
- Using cold ingredients: Cold cream cheese or sour cream can make it hard to mix. Always let them sit at room temperature first.
- Overcooking pasta: Overcooked pasta can turn mushy. Cook it al dente for the best texture in your salad.
- Not seasoning enough: Salt and pepper enhance flavors. Taste and adjust seasoning before serving to ensure a balanced dish.
- Ignoring freshness of ingredients: Using stale herbs or old corn can affect the flavor. Always select fresh produce for the best taste.
- Skipping the acid: Lime juice adds brightness. Don’t forget this crucial ingredient—it elevates the overall flavor profile.
